What the teacher wants done in the classroom Explains how to do something; how to get something done Increases on-task time and reduces classroom disruptions Demonstrate how students are to function in an ACCEPTABLE AND
ORGANIZED MANNER. All procedures need to be explained, rehearsed, and reinforced
What the difference between a procedure and rule? Procedures concern how things are DONE Discipline concerns how students BEHAVE
What is the procedure for opening a locker? Does a student get a JUG if he can’t open his locker? Does a student get a JUG if he breaks into a locker or opens the
locker of another student? The goal of procedures is ROUTINE! Students do it automatically,
“knowing it like their name tattooed on their brain!” “AND WHAT’S THE PROCEDURE PLEASE?”
